AI Summary

  • Allows individuals to bring civil lawsuits against property or casualty insurers for damages resulting from unfair methods of competition, unfair or deceptive acts or practices, or other prohibited conduct under sections 2001 to 2050 of the Insurance Code.

  • Defines "property or casualty insurer" to include home insurers, automobile insurers, commercial property insurers, and workers' compensation insurers.

  • Bill takes effect only upon enactment of seven related bills: HB 5518, HB 5519, HB 5520, HB 5522, HB 5523, HB 5525, and one additional bill (request no. 03846'13).

Legislative Description

Insurance; unfair trade practices; private citizen cause of action; provide for. Amends 1956 PA 218 (MCL 500.100 - 500.8302) by adding sec. 2027c. TIE BAR WITH: HB 5518'14, HB 5519'14, HB 5520'14, HB 5522'14, HB 5523'14, HB 5525'14
